We had a strange thing happen in our last game. I'm fighting and losing to a monster that has "You are dead" as bad stuff. A level 9 player who has the "dark" race modifier has used abilities and cards against me. I fail to run away and play "Rocks fall, everyone dies". Does he win? I know you can't level up while dead but which one happens first, death or level-up?

In the wording of
Dark it says that you go up a level (and it can be the winning level) if you cause a player to suffer bad stuff which includes death. In the instance that everyone has died, my assumption (and my groups) was that this would entitle the
Dark player to gain the winning level, as it is not linked directly to to the after effects of the combat - in essence the
Dark player would get the level as an effect of their race ability (interfering in the combat making the player suffer the bad stuff including death) due to the fact that you do not lose your race or class for dieing (with some exceptions)
In Short, it is a race ability - you don't lose the race, and you meet the criteria for the level.
